Top Attractions & Must-Visit Places in Gruyère District, Switzerland
Gruyères Castle
This iconic medieval castle, perched high on a hill, is a must-see. Explore its fascinating history, wander through its grand halls, and soak in the breathtaking views of the surrounding countryside. It's the perfect Instagram backdrop!
HR Giger Museum
For a more unique experience, head to the HR Giger Museum, dedicated to the surrealist artist behind the Alien franchise. It's definitely not your average museum visit – prepare for some seriously mind-bending art!
La Maison du Gruyère
Learn all about the making of the famous Gruyère cheese at La Maison du Gruyère. You'll get to see the process firsthand and, of course, sample the delicious results. It's a truly immersive experience.

Best Zones & Areas to Explore in Gruyère District, Switzerland
- Gruyères: The heart of the region, with its castle, cheese factory, and charming streets.
- Broc: Home to the Cailler chocolate factory, a sweet treat for any visitor.
- Charmey: A picturesque village known for its thermal baths and stunning scenery.

Best Time to Visit Gruyère District, Switzerland
Summer (June-August) offers pleasant weather ideal for hiking and outdoor activities. Shoulder seasons (spring and autumn) provide a quieter experience with fewer crowds. Winter (December-February) is perfect for snow activities, but be prepared for colder temperatures.
Transportation Options in Gruyère District, Switzerland
The region is well-served by public transport, with buses connecting the main towns and villages. Consider using local buses and trains for efficient travel within the Gruyère District. For exploring the surrounding countryside, renting a car might be a good option.
